 Description 


EAGLE'S NEST - Renting Year Round What a great way to enjoy all of the wonders of Lake Vermilion ! The ultimate choice for your vacation, Eagle's Nest Cabin offers the perfect combination of privacy, nature and lakeside living, with all the modern conveniences of your own home. Built in October 2003 and newly available for rental in 2004, the cabin is situated on the east end of Black Bay on Lake Vermilion, Minnesota., and is surrounded by state forest or undeveloped property. It sits 50 feet above the lake level, offering spectacular views of the lake and the surrounding forest. This road-accessible site sits on 3.1 acres of land and features 285 feet of private shoreline for your enjoyment. THE CABIN Enjoy the simplicity of nature in all its beauty from this comfortable lodge. This cabin was designed to be spacious, taking advantage of views from all sides, while having all of the luxuries of a fine home. The interior features wood floors throughout, with tile in the entrance way and bathrooms. The open-plan living room, dining room and kitchen feature a vaulted pine ceiling with cedar beams, with great views out all the windows. The cabin has six panel pine doors, maple cabinets and cedar trim throughout. It also features in-floor heat in all of the rooms on the first floor, standard ceiling fans with remotes in every room and a wood-burning fireplace in the living room.

THE DOCK The dock is designed in the shape of a "W". Each finger of the "W" is 24 feet long. It can accommodate two boats in-between the dock sections and two boats on the outside. The there is a covering over the top of the first two dock sections. However, the ends and the last section of dock remain open for easy boat launching and fishing. THE PROPERTY The property is located in a nicely forested area with a mix of ash, birch and pines. The house site is elevated above the rest of the property, providing excellent views and is still only 100 feet from the water. The road also provides access to the south side of the property, all the way down to the lake, where the private boat dock is located. Almost all of the south side of the bay (139 acres) is state of Minnesota forest land. These lands are undeveloped but host some nice hiking trails. The north side of the bay is privately owned and is undeveloped. There are a total of only five more homes on the entire upper part of the bay, with your nearest neighbor being 1 mile away! Road access is provided from a two-mile private road (Wilderness Way Road), off of County Highway 24 to the cabin site.  Attractions 


NATURE At Eagle's Nest Cabin on :Lake Vermilion you are placed right in the middle of all of natures beauty. You can simply sit in the living room and look out the windows or take a walk in the forest. The Superior National Forest hosts the greatest diversity of breeding birds of any National Forest. You can see bald eagles, loons, osprey, white pelicans, and great blue herons to name just a few. You have plenty of opportunity to see wolves, deer, moose, bear, otters, beavers, mink, fisher and many other wildlife species. Or enjoy the diversity of plants throughout the forest FISHING Lake Vermilion is a fisherman's paradise. It features a growing population of walleye, bass, northerns, and pan fish. A trophy fish is just a cast away. You can simply fish from the dock or shorline or take a boat to hit the many hotsopts on the lake. Lake Vermilion has a large range of fishing guides that can assist you in finding the best lure, the best locations, and make your fishing experience even more enjoyable. BOATING Lake Vermilion is a great lake to take a sail on or enjoy a power boat ride. With 1,200 miles of shoreline, countless bays and islands, and 35 mile distance from end to end you can spend entire days just cruising the lake and enjoying the sights. Of course there is plenty of room for water skiing, tubing, jet skiing, canoeing. There are several good public access boat ramps on the lake as well as a host of Marina's for fueling, service, and repair. We suggest that you place your boat in the water at one of the public access sites and then bring it to our dock. HIKING Taking a hike is a wonderful way to get out and see nature and to get some exercise. Staying at Eagle's Nest cabin you are at the gateway to one of the nicest water access only hiking trails. The Black Bay Peninsula Hiking Trail offers six miles of scenic, well-maintained trails. Simply take a short boat ride to the state forest pier located 1/2 mile down on the south side of the bay and you are there. Alternatively take a walk on our forest road and explore the area.
